This video tutorial covers the calculation of vector magnitudes and angles, focusing on using the Pythagorean theorem and trigonometric functions. It explains how to determine vector properties from given components and addresses potential issues with angle calculations in different quadrants. The tutorial emphasizes the importance of verifying results and provides a roadmap for future lessons on vector addition and motion.
